2009-10-11 10 views
9

NSInvalidUnarchiveOperationException ', कारण:' *** - [NSKeyedUnarchiver decodeObjectForKey:]: वर्ग (MKMapView) की वस्तुएक्सकोड में मैपकिट का उपयोग करते समय त्रुटि प्राप्त हो रही है?

मैं इस error.Have मैं कुछ छूट गया हो रही है डिकोड नहीं कर सकते हैं?

मुझे पता नहीं है कि मैपकिट फ्रेमवर्क कहां से जोड़ना है। सबसे पहले मैंने target->getInfo और फिर नीचे + साइन जोड़ा फ्रेमवर्क के साथ प्रयास किया लेकिन यह काम नहीं किया। तब मैंने स्पॉटलाइट में खोज की और एक और ढांचा जोड़ा। इसे जोड़कर इसे पिछली त्रुटि हटा दी गई लेकिन उपर्युक्त एक देता है।

मैपकिट ढांचे का सही स्थान क्या है? मैं सिम्युलेटर में इसका परीक्षण करना चाहता हूं।

उत्तर

12

फ़्रेमवर्क (यह मानते हुए 3.x) /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.0.sdk/System/Library/Frameworks

2
Xcode 3.2 के साथ

में हैं, MapKit है जोड़ें → मौजूदा फ्रेमवर्क में पूर्व-जनसंख्या ... संवाद और बस सूची से मैपकिट का चयन करने के लिए की आवश्यकता है।

http://cs491f09.wordpress.com/2009/10/30/assignment-6-adding-the-mapkit-framework/

+0

कहा, मैं सिम्युलेटर में यह काम कर पाने के लिए कर रहा हूँ, लेकिन फिर जब मैं डिवाइस पर यह कोशिश यह मेरे ऊपर के रूप में ही 'NSInvalidUnarchiveOperationException' त्रुटि देता है। – daidai

संबंधित मुद्दे